@rainboworiental95219 ай бұрын
The real dominators of China's bank sector are always Big Four state-owned commercial banks. To clarify, they are the China Bank, China Commercial Bank, China Agriculture Bank, and China Construction Bank. Each of them manages trillions of US dollars in assets and deposits and operates in every town and county across the entire country. They have the same level of financial power and even can compete with HBSC, USB, and JP Morgan, and all were controlled by the State-owned assets commision

The most important part of this is can they trust the banks themselves? I think as of current years, its not going to be easy to trust if they will release accurate financial information (financial statements released by state-owned corporations aren't exactly the most truthful, compared to its peers in other countries). By this point in time, the majority of banks have huge amounts of underperforming loans, and its likely that the banks they have invested in have the same problem. (Luckily for them, there is no such thing as personal bankruptcy, so they would only have to worry about corporate defaults, not personal mortgage defaults). What's happening in the Chinese banking system right now is similar to what happened to Japanese banks in the 90's, and what happened to US banks in the late 2000's. We can't even be sure if the CCP will bail out the banks. Well, the higher profit, the higher the risk. The CCP could immediately change the rules, and Singapore to instantly loose all their money at any time (unlikely to happen if China wants continued foreign investment, but the idea that it could, and that it has happened before increases the risk factor).
